Perfect Square
307776403945040862106097447003978500824099833041 is a perfect square (554775994384256736565321 × 554775994384256736565321)
307776403945040862106097447003978500824099833041 is a perfect square (554775994384256736565321 × 554775994384256736565321)
307776403945040862106097447003978500824099833041 is odd
Previous odd number is 307776403945040862106097447003978500824099833039
Next odd number is 307776403945040862106097447003978500824099833043
11010111101001001010111101100001100010011011011001100100110111000100101000001010110011010110000000000110101011010011110001000011110001011100011100010011010001
29154524535909253481996922433086873417392763988166650402722928679818126444663693635479178915633545914228748655097106867113252324025702804887921
94726314825340964347169584262971148902482952609831122788910047870360055704647771818204075307681